It has to write to the data/ directory and various subdirectories under that.
The data directory is created by checksetup.pl. You can change where Bugzilla
expects the data directory to be by editing the $datadir variable in
Bugzilla/Config.pm.

Why can't we put something in /var/www? It's where we normally put Bugzilla.

Also note that Bugzilla requires *either* DBD::Pg or DBD::mysql, but it doesn't
need both. I'm not sure how to handle that in RPM. The automatic deps will
probably pick up both.
